Introduction to Azure Resource Manager
Template Deployment & Advanced Concepts
The course is part of these learning pathsSee 3 more
This lecture introduces the challenges of provisioning resources in the cloud the "old way," and shows how declarative provisioning can improve the speed at which cloud resources can be deployed. Furthermore, declarative provisioning ensures that your cloud infrastructure can be managed "as code," such that it can be revision controlled using industry standards tools such as Git.
Hi, my name is Trevor Sullivan, a Microsoft MVP for Windows PowerShell.
First, you'll author your JSON file that contains a declarative infrastructure for your cloud subscription. You'll commit that file to source control every time that you make a change. You'll deploy that JSON file to your Azure dev environment.
Then once you've confirmed the functionality in dev, you can deploy to the QA environment. Once QA and test has signed off on that infrastructure configuration the operations team can then deploy that same infrastructure to the production environment.
About the Author
Trevor Sullivan is a Microsoft MVP for Windows PowerShell, and enjoys working with cloud and automation technologies. As a strong, vocal veteran of the Microsoft-centric IT field since 2004, Trevor has developed open source projects, provided significant amounts of product feedback, authored a large variety of training resources, and presented at IT functions including worldwide user groups and conferences.